Finding a trustworthy Roofing Contractor in Citrus

Selecting a reliable Roofing Contractor in Citrus using owner shingles is essential to protect your property and home. It could be costly to select the wrong contractor, and poor quality workmanship could lead to legal problems. This article provides a few guidelines to aid you in making the right decision.

The first thing you need to do is check with your local Better Business Bureau. If a company has a poor rating it is best to stay clear of it. The BBB will also assist you to discover if the Roofing Contractor in Citrus is member of any trade associations. These associations represent a commitment to professionalism and the highest standards.

Another way to determine whether a roofing company is credible is to read reviews. The majority of roofing companies will provide references. If a former customer is unhappy, they’ll go to great lengths to leave a negative review.

You should also ask the Roofing Contractor in Citrus for insurance. If they don’t have insurance, they could be held accountable for any accidents that occur that occur on your property. It is recommended to request copies of their insurance certificates.

Overlay shingles make up a larger portion of the cost

Roofing shingles are constructed out of a variety of materials and each has its unique style and cost. The price per square foot varies depending on the type of material and the dimensions of the shingle, as well as whether it is nailed or fixed to an old roof.

In general, the most cost-effective method of replacing your roof is to apply an additional layer of shingles over your current roof. It typically is less than $5,500 for a 1,500-square-foot roofing, and can save you time and money. The main drawback to covering your roof is that you can’t see the deck underneath it to assess for any water damage or other issues.

Other problems associated with overlaying your roof is that the shingles used in an overlay may not last as long as the shingles that you’d apply to the traditional replacement of your roof. Also, they’re not as visually attractive.

Another issue that comes with overlaying your roof is the number of layers it will require. It is necessary to take off some of the unnoticed parts of your roof in order in order to get the new layer put in place, which can add to the cost.
